Synthesis-Aided Development of Distributed Programs

Despite many advances in programming models and frameworks, writing distributed programs remains hard. Even when the underlying logic is inherently sequential and simple, addressing distributed aspects results in complex cross-cutting code that undermines such simplicity. While the sequential comput...

Full description

Bibliographic Details
Main Author: Kuraj, Ivan
Other Authors: Solar-Lezama, Armando
Format: Thesis
Published: Massachusetts Institute of Technology 2024
Online Access:https://hdl.handle.net/1721.1/153838